The Seafood Awards 2009
The Seafood Awards 2009 take place on 21 May 2009 at the Marriott, Grosvenor Square in London. This is the third time the Seafish initiative has run and it's designed to encourage enterprise and innovation throughout the seafood industry. Whether you are a processor, retailer, frier, fisherman, restaurateur, fishmonger or any other member of the industry, there is an award category to represent you. Quality Food Awards 2008
QFA  2008 logo The Quality Food Awards 2008 took place on 27 November at the Battersea Evolution in London. Now in their 29th year the Quality Food Awards are the most prestigious awards for food and drink products on sale in UK grocery outlets.
 
Retail Industry Awards 2008: about the awards
Retail awards Now entering their 13th year, the Retail Industry Awards have become firmly established as the “Oscars” of the grocery industry, rewarding excellence in a raft of retail categories. The 2008 Retail Industry Awards were held on 25 September at the Grosvenor House Hotel in London. As always, the event was a unique occasion. The whole industry got together to recognise the smallest independent retailers alongside the largest supermarket groups.
